Expenditure under Pradhan Mantri Gram Sadak Yojana from 2015-16 to 2017-18

September 29, 2020

The total expenditure was Rs. 13646.66 crores in India under Pradhan Mantri Gram Sadak Yojana (PMGSY) during 2017-18 (upto February, 2018). The top 5 States/UTs with respect to expenditure under PMGSY during 2017-18 (upto February, 2018) were Odisha, Madhya Pradesh, Uttar Pradesh, Bihar and Jharkhand.

Expenditure incurred under PMGSY was Rs. 2200.42 crores in Orisha during 2017-18 (upto February, 2018), up by 48.74% against Rs. 1479.39 crores during 2016-17. Odisha accounted 16.12% of the total expenditure under PMGSY during 2017-18 (upto February, 2018). We have observed growth of 21.03% of expenditure under PMGSY in Madhya Pradesh from Rs. 1393.94 crores during 2016-17 to Rs. 1687.12 crores during 2017-18 (upto February, 2018).
